The suspected coordinated drone attack on the nuclear power plants Forsmark, Oskarshamn, Ringhals and the closed Barsebäck on Friday night, is now being investigated as a national special event.

At the same time, experts believe that the Swedish system is not sufficiently prepared for this type of event.

- We have not really adapted our way of looking at this type of event to today's reality.

We still think of the world as either in peace or in war, says Hans Liwång, associate professor at the Swedish National Defense College.
